Différences
Ci-dessous, les différences entre deux révisions de la page.
Prochaine révision | Révision précédente | ||
hdf5 [2015/01/17 08:54] – créée gerard | hdf5 [2017/08/25 09:56] (Version actuelle) – modification externe 127.0.0.1 | ||
---|---|---|---|
Ligne 74: | Ligne 74: | ||
Large File Support (LFS): yes | Large File Support (LFS): yes | ||
</ | </ | ||
+ | |||
+ | ====== pour linux/ | ||
+ | < | ||
+ | ./configure --prefix=/ | ||
+ | --enable-production FC=f95 \ | ||
+ | LDFLAGS=" | ||
+ | </ | ||
+ | |||
+ | < | ||
+ | config.status: | ||
+ | SUMMARY OF THE HDF5 CONFIGURATION | ||
+ | ================================= | ||
+ | |||
+ | General Information: | ||
+ | ------------------- | ||
+ | HDF5 Version: 1.8.14 | ||
+ | Configured on: Mon Feb 23 18:30:10 CET 2015 | ||
+ | Configured by: devel1@judith.cmi.univ-mrs.fr | ||
+ | | ||
+ | Host system: x86_64-unknown-linux-gnu | ||
+ | Uname information: | ||
+ | Byte sex: little-endian | ||
+ | Libraries: static, shared | ||
+ | | ||
+ | |||
+ | Compiling Options: | ||
+ | ------------------ | ||
+ | | ||
+ | C Compiler: /bin/gcc ( gcc (GCC) 4.8.2 20140120 ) | ||
+ | | ||
+ | H5_CFLAGS: -std=c99 -pedantic -Wall -Wextra -Wundef -Wshadow -Wpointer-arith -Wbad-function-cast -Wcast-qual -Wcast-align -Wwrite-strings -Wconversion -Waggregate-return -Wstrict-prototypes -Wmissing-prototypes -Wmissing-declarations -Wredundant-decls -Wnested-externs -Winline -Wfloat-equal -Wmissing-format-attribute -Wmissing-noreturn -Wpacked -Wdisabled-optimization -Wformat=2 -Wunreachable-code -Wendif-labels -Wdeclaration-after-statement -Wold-style-definition -Winvalid-pch -Wvariadic-macros -Winit-self -Wmissing-include-dirs -Wswitch-default -Wswitch-enum -Wunused-macros -Wunsafe-loop-optimizations -Wc++-compat -Wstrict-overflow -Wlogical-op -Wlarger-than=2048 -Wvla -Wsync-nand -Wframe-larger-than=16384 -Wpacked-bitfield-compat -Wstrict-overflow=5 -Wjump-misses-init -Wunsuffixed-float-constants -Wdouble-promotion -Wsuggest-attribute=const -Wtrampolines -Wstack-usage=8192 -Wvector-operation-performance -Wsuggest-attribute=pure -Wsuggest-attribute=noreturn -Wsuggest-attribute=format -O3 -fomit-frame-pointer -finline-functions | ||
+ | AM_CFLAGS: | ||
+ | | ||
+ | H5_CPPFLAGS: | ||
+ | AM_CPPFLAGS: | ||
+ | | ||
+ | | ||
+ | Statically Linked Executables: | ||
+ | LDFLAGS: -L/ | ||
+ | | ||
+ | | ||
+ | Extra libraries: | ||
+ | | ||
+ | | ||
+ | Debugged Packages: | ||
+ | API Tracing: no | ||
+ | |||
+ | Languages: | ||
+ | ---------- | ||
+ | Fortran: yes | ||
+ | | ||
+ | Fortran 2003 Compiler: no | ||
+ | Fortran Flags: | ||
+ | H5 Fortran Flags: | ||
+ | AM Fortran Flags: | ||
+ | | ||
+ | | ||
+ | |||
+ | C++: no | ||
+ | |||
+ | Features: | ||
+ | --------- | ||
+ | Parallel HDF5: no | ||
+ | High Level library: yes | ||
+ | | ||
+ | Default API Mapping: v18 | ||
+ | With Deprecated Public Symbols: yes | ||
+ | I/O filters (external): deflate(zlib) | ||
+ | I/O filters (internal): shuffle, | ||
+ | MPE: no | ||
+ | | ||
+ | dmalloc: no | ||
+ | Clear file buffers before write: yes | ||
+ | Using memory checker: no | ||
+ | | ||
+ | Strict File Format Checks: no | ||
+ | | ||
+ | Large File Support (LFS): yes | ||
+ | </ | ||
+ | ====== Tests ====== | ||
+ | avec un des exemples fournis sur le site: dsetexample | ||
+ | < | ||
+ | tara:hdf5 me$ make -f Makefile.hdf5 | ||
+ | gfortran -o dsetexample dsetexample.f90 -I/ | ||
+ | Undefined symbols for architecture x86_64: | ||
+ | " | ||
+ | _H5Z_filter_deflate in libhdf5.a(H5Zdeflate.o) | ||
+ | " | ||
+ | _H5Z_filter_deflate in libhdf5.a(H5Zdeflate.o) | ||
+ | " | ||
+ | _H5Z_filter_deflate in libhdf5.a(H5Zdeflate.o) | ||
+ | " | ||
+ | _H5Z_filter_deflate in libhdf5.a(H5Zdeflate.o) | ||
+ | ld: symbol(s) not found for architecture x86_64 | ||
+ | collect2: error: ld returned 1 exit status | ||
+ | make: *** [dsetexample] Error 1 | ||
+ | </ | ||
+ |